Bullas
3 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on baking soda
¼ te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on cinnamon
¼ teaspoon nutmeg
½ teaspoon ground ginger
½ teaspoon allspice
One 1-oz. glass New Sugar (wet sugar)
Just sufficient water to blend sugar into a thick syrup
2 tablespoons melted butter
A substitute may be made for New Sugar using 10 ozs. very dark brown sugar and proceeding with just sufficient water to make a thick syrup as above.
Sieve all dry ingredients together, make a well in centre of same and pour the thick syrup into this well, add melted butter and blend all together lightly. Turn out on well floured board and pat with your hands to a thickness of ¼ inch or a wee bit thicker. Cut into circles, using an ordinary drinking glass for this purpose. Raise bullas with a well floured spatula and place on a slightly greased and well floured Patty Making Tin. Bake at 400F for roughly 20 minutes.
From "A Merry Go Round of RECIPES from Jamaica"
